OTS Reports

The Instructor has the ability to select the type and number of printed reports produced when a test is scored.  After a new course is setup, one copy of all of the combined reports are automatically printed and will continue to be produced with each new scoring, unless you specify otherwise on the Report Selection Request form.  The Report Selection Request form allows you to select which current test and cumulative gradebook reports are produced.

The reports you receive after your exam is scored are printed on continuous (8.5" x 14") forms which contain the following types of information: performance of students, performance of the exam items, performance of the exam as a whole, students enrollment, and Id numbers.   In addition each page of the report includes a standard heading with the report title, the date and time prepared, the test number and name, the instructors name, college, slot number and phone number.  It also includes in the title the course title and number of students present, absent and withdrawn.

Students scores are reported on one or more of the following scales:
Raw ScoreSimple sum of points earned
Percent ScoreRaw Score is divided by maximum possible raw score points times 100
Raw Rank in Class1 is considered highest and ties receive same rank
Percentile Rankpercent of students who scored lower than given students
Z-scoreStandardized score in which original raw scores have been shifted to a uniform standardized scale having a mean of 500 and a standard deviation of 100. Note: Z-scores are useful in comparing a single student's performance across several different item categories, across test within the same course, or across test in different courses

These are a list of the current exam reports that are commonly used...

  1. Error Listing (mandatory)
  2. Test Analysis Summary
  3. Item Analysis
  4. Item Analysis by Category
  5. Department Report
  6. Student Roll
  7. Students by Rank
  8. Raw Score Histogram
  9. Z-score Histogram
  10. Posting Report
  11. Student Letter

Note: Student letter report is an individual form to the student that is printed on 8.5 x 11 paper.  It contains current exam results as well as scores from their other exams.  The report can optionally contain the correct answer and students response to each item.  It can be printed in either Student name order or Id number order.

There are several kinds of gradebooks available.  The Raw Score and Percent Score gradebooks are most commonly used.  There is also a Z-Score gradebook which is used less.  It is to your advantage to select only the gradebooks that will be of use to you.  This will save you from sorting through unwanted reports.  For each of the 3 types of gradebooks you can select to receive any or all of the following reports:

  1. Instructors alpha ordered cumulative report
  2. Instructors cumulative rank report
  3. Posting report which is Id-ordered showing cumulative scores
  4. Posting report which is a cumulative rank report

NOTE: The Posting reports are the only reports of individual students scores which are designed to be publicly posted.  These reports are always arranged in ascending student Id number order.  They may be posted only as long as the confidentiality of student ID numbers has not been compromised.
